AWARD flash commands:
/CC = clear cmos data after programming
/CD = clear dmi data after programming
/CP = clear pnp (escd) data after programming
/R = reset system after programming
/PY = program flash memory
other awdflash commands:
/? = show help menu
/SY = backup original bios to disk
/SB = skip bootblock programming
/TINY = occupy lesser memory
/E = return to dos when programming is done
/F = use flash routines in original bios for flash programming
/LD = destroy cmos checksum and no system halt for first reboot after programming
/CKSxxxx = compare binfile checksum with xxxx
/CKS = show update binfile checksum
/PN = no flash programming
/SN = no original bios backup
/SD = save dmi data to file
Recommended way to flash:
awdflash {drive:\filename} /f /py /sn /cc /cd /cp /LD /E
